Gear inches is a measure of bicycle gearing that gives the equivalent diameter of the drive wheel on a penny-farthing bicycle. It's a useful way to compare gearing across different bicycles.

Explanation: The equation calculates how far the bike travels with one complete pedal revolution.
Details: Gear inches helps cyclists understand how "hard" or "easy" a particular gear combination will feel. Higher gear inches mean more distance per pedal revolution but require more effort.

Q1: What's a typical gear inch range?
A: Road bikes might range from 30-120 gear inches, while mountain bikes often range from 20-100 gear inches.
Q2: How does gear inches relate to speed?
A: Higher gear inches allow higher speeds at the same pedal cadence, but require more power to turn.
Q3: What wheel diameter should I use?
A: Measure your actual wheel diameter with tire inflated, or use standard sizes (e.g., 26" for MTB, 700c is about 27" for road bikes).
Q4: Why use gear inches instead of gear ratios?
A: Gear inches incorporates wheel size, making it easier to compare different bikes directly.
Q5: How does this help with gear selection?
A: By calculating gear inches for different combinations, you can find gears that match your preferred pedaling effort and terrain.
